Artisan™ Pre-Colored Thermoplastics
Artisan™ AR7300 pre-colored thermoplastics are customized ABS formulations to help manufacturers achieve
brilliant and high-gloss metallic effect, excellent chemical resistance, and scratch resistance.
Compared with
a traditional painting process, injection-molded Artisan materials also offer additional sustainable benefits:
energy use and VOC emissions are reduced by eliminating secondary painting or in-mold labeling.

These special-effect, highly reflective colorants meet a growing need for paint replacement and truly premium surface finishes.
Manufacturers are looking for high-performance, paint-free solutions, especially among Asia’s booming automotive and household appliance industries.
With uniquely shaped and sized pigment particles, they create metallic shades that replicate the look of paint to help customers replace painted metal parts or even plating on plastic parts.

SYNCURE™
Cross-Linked Polyethylene for Power Cable Insulation
• Resistant to heat, oil, creep and abrasion
• Fast extrusion speeds
• UL 44 & UL 4703 flame performance
• UL/CSA bulletins
MAXXAM™ FR W&C
Flame Retardant Polypropylene for Category Cable
Insulation and Cross-Webs
• Alternative to FEP
• Low dielectric
• Thin wall extrusion capabilities
• UL 444 & plenum yellow card flame performance
FIRECON™
Flame Retardant Chlorinated Polyethylene
for Industrial Cable Jackets
• Resistance to harsh environments
• Low temperature properties
• UV resistance
• UL 44 flame performance
ECCOH™ LSFOH
Low Smoke and Fume, Non-Halogen for Insulation
and Jackets
• Low smoke and toxicity
• Improved fire safety
• Resistance to chemicals
• UL44 and CPR flame performance

https://www.avient.com/idea/should-polymers-be-used-instead-aluminum-advanced-driver-assistance-system-housings
But because ADAS housing applications are typically convection limited, custom formulated thermoplastics can do the job of dissipating heat exceptionally well.
Damage from static electricity – Your electronics need protection from static buildup – specialty thermoplastics can be formulated to do a better job of dissipating unwanted static and therefore minimize the potential for damage to nearby electrical components.
No need to face the extra processing times or costs that go into painting or vacuum metallization required with traditional polymer formulations.
